BCMA-targeted therapies for multiple myeloma: latest updates from 2024 ASH annual meeting
Huijian Zheng1, Huajian Xian2, Wenjie Zhang1
1Fujian Provincial Key Laboratory on Hematology, Fujian Institute of Hematology, Fujian Medical University Union Hospital, 29 Xinquan Rd, Fuzhou, 350001, China.
Abstract:
B-cell maturation antigen (BCMA) is currently the most extensively explored target for multiple myeloma (MM). BCMA-targeted therapies such as antibody-drug conjugate (ADC), bispecific antibodies (BsAbs), chimeric antigen receptor T(CAR-T) cell have shown promising therapeutic prospects in MM. We have summarized the latest reports on the three types of drugs for MM at the 2024 ASH Annual Meeting.

Background:
- B-cell maturation antigen (BCMA) is a primary therapeutic target in multiple myeloma (MM).
- BCMA-targeted therapies represent a significant advancement in MM treatment strategies.
- The 2024 American Society of Hematology (ASH) Annual Meeting showcased novel developments in BCMA-directed treatments.
Discussion:
- Antibody-drug conjugates (ADCs) deliver cytotoxic agents directly to BCMA-expressing cells.
- Bispecific antibodies (BsAbs) engage both T-cells and BCMA-expressing myeloma cells.
- Chimeric antigen receptor T (CAR-T) cell therapy redirects a patient's own T-cells to target BCMA.
Key Insights:
- All three modalities—ADCs, BsAbs, and CAR-T cells—demonstrated promising efficacy in preclinical and clinical studies.
- Emerging data suggest potential for deep and durable responses across different patient populations.
- Comparisons of efficacy, safety, and logistical considerations are crucial for clinical decision-making.
Outlook:
- Continued research will refine patient selection and optimize treatment protocols for BCMA-targeted therapies.
- Combination strategies involving BCMA-targeted agents may further enhance therapeutic outcomes.
- The development pipeline for BCMA-targeted therapies remains robust, offering hope for improved MM management.
